313/2011
9403208000

TV stand

The furniture is designed to hold a television, measuring approximately 80 × 40 × 45 cm, composed of a top surface and two transparent tempered glass shelves, supported by four cylindrical metal legs (45 × 5 cm). Maximum load capacity: 80 kg. The value of the metal parts (approximately 47%) and glass parts (approximately 44%) is comparable. Main use: furniture for audiovisual equipment. Regulatory particularities: compliant with furniture legislation (safety, stability, absence of hazardous substances – REACH), strength requirements, no CE marking unless integrated into an electrical furniture set.

840/92
9403208000

Item 2: Mobile shelving-unit of a height up to 225 cm, consisting of a base mounted on four small wheels, with four steel corner- supports and at least two wooden shelves. The shelving-unit is generally used during the transport and storage of goods sold by florists

Classification is determined by General Rules 1, 3 (b) and 6 for the interpretation of the combined nomenclature, note 2 to Chapter 94 and the wording of CN codes 9403, 9403 20 and 9403 20 80 Classification as a container is precluded because the shelving unit is open all sides Documented CN 2026 code: 94032080.

1964/90
9403208000

Item 6: Ice-storage bin for the storage of ice- cubes. The bin consists of a shaped frame with an internal container of steel sheet. The bin is double-skinned, with a layer of foam plastic between the skins

The classification is determined by the provisions of General Rules 1 and 6 for the interpretation of the combined nomenclature and by the text of CN codes 9403, 9403 20 and 9403 20 80. The goods in question are not equipped with a refrigerating unit nor are they designed to receive one (see Harmonized System Explanatory Notes, heading 94.03, exclusion (h)). Documented CN 2026 code: 94032080.
